How Many Coats Of Primer On Interior Door . One coat of primer is usually enough if you are painting over walls with a similar color and the wall is smooth, undamaged, and in great shape. Generally, one to two coats of primer will suffice for painting interior walls, but how many you’ll need depends on the wall material, the paint color, and the type of primer used.
